How does the "Forte" version compare to the regular Aqua Allegoria line?+−
The Forte version is designed to be a deeper and more concentrated interpretation. While the original line is known for being light and fleeting, the Forte editions, including Rosa Palissandro, offer a "rounder" feel and significantly better longevity, often lasting twice as long on the skin.
Is this fragrance truly unisex or does it lean feminine?+−
While it features rose, the heavy emphasis on rosewood, cardamom, and sandalwood gives it a dry, woody character that appeals to all genders. It avoids the sugary sweetness often associated with feminine perfumes, making it a solid choice for anyone who enjoys woody-floral compositions.
Can this be worn in the heat of summer?+−
Yes, though it is slightly heavier than the standard EDT, the bergamot and fresh spices keep it airy enough for summer. However, the community finds it shines brightest during spring and autumn when the woodiness can really breathe.
